Hickory festival set July 23–25
By Furniture Today Staff -- Furniture Today, July 12, 2004
Hickory, N.C. — The sixth annual Hickory Heritage Furnishings Festival will be take place July 23–25 at the Catawba Furniture Mall here.
The event, which originated as the North Carolina Furnishings Festival in High Point in 1997 and moved to Hickory in 1999, honors the industry and features exhibits, games, contests, food and entertainment.
An exhibitor reception will take place at 5 p.m. July 23, followed by opening ceremonies at 6 p.m. Activities, which are free and open to the public, will include art appraisals, furniture exhibits, manufacturer and furniture crafting demonstrations, free interior design consultations, and a variety of furniture and accessories for sale.
